bluff

noun: a high steep bank (usually formed by river erosion)

noun: pretense that your position is stronger than it really is; "his bluff succeeded in getting him accepted"

noun: the act of bluffing in poker; deception by a false show of confidence in the strength of your cards

verb: deceive an opponent by a bold bet on an inferior hand with the result that the opponent withdraws a winning hand

verb: frighten someone by pretending to be stronger than one really is

adj: very steep; having a prominent and almost vertical front; "a bluff headland"; "where the bold chalk cliffs of England rise"; "a sheer descent of rock"

adj: bluntly direct and outspoken but good-natured; "a bluff but pleasant manner"; "a bluff and rugged natural leader"
